The whole idea
DayLoop lives on a single screen, chat in front and your calendar quietly behind it. Everything happens right here.
Type or speak a plain sentence, snap a flyer, or share a document. No fields to fill.
DayLoop pulls out the title, day, time, and place and shows a card. A complete event adds itself after a 6-second countdown. Tap Cancel to stop it, Edit to tweak.
The card folds into a green check on your own message. That is the whole loop, every time.

The preview card
DayLoop shows what it understood before anything touches your calendar. A complete event counts down and adds itself; anything unclear waits for a quick tap.
Ask your calendar
Ask about your own schedule and DayLoop reads it back. It knows the difference between "add" and "when is". A question never creates anything and never counts toward your monthly total.
Change things
"Move my dentist to 5pm." "Cancel soccer Thursday." DayLoop finds the event and shows a confirmation card. Nothing changes until you tap Confirm.
Always right there
Swipe down from the chat and your calendar is waiting, in Day, Week, or Month. Tap an event to open it, drag it to a new slot, or edit it in place. Chat and calendar are two views of the same thing.
Better together
On Pro, share a link and everyone lands on the same calendar. Anyone can add or edit; everyone sees the adds and answers in one shared chat.
The owner shares a deep link. No phone numbers, no SMS from DayLoop.
Everyone's existing events merge into the shared calendar when they join.
Every add and every answer is visible to the whole household.
Only the owner manages the subscription and invites. Members just use the calendar.
